Earthworks and Foundation Engineering

Earthworks and foundation engineering represent the crucial primary stages in any construction project. They involve a comprehensive interplay of read more soil investigations, site preparation, excavation, and the construction of sturdy foundations to sustain the weight of the superstructure. Earthworks encompass activities such as grading, stabilization, and drainage, ensuring a level and stable surface for construction. Foundation engineering focuses on planning the foundation system based on soil conditions, load requirements, and building codes. Foundations can vary from simple shallow slabs to complex deep foundations like piles or caissons, depending on the characteristics of the soil and the scale of the structure.

Site Preparation and Excavation Operations

Before any construction can commence, the site must undergo thorough preparation and excavation procedures. This crucial stage involves a variety of activities aimed at clearing, leveling, and preparing the ground for construction.

First, existing structures, vegetation, and debris are removed to make way for the new project. Subsequently, the site is graded to create a stable and even foundation. Excavation tasks then take place to trench trenches or pits for foundations, utilities, and other below-grade elements.

Throughout these processes, safety is paramount. Construction crews strictly adhere to industry guidelines to guarantee a secure work environment. They utilize appropriate equipment and protective gear to minimize risks and mitigate potential hazards.
